Requirements

  • High School Diploma/GED or equivalent work experience
  • 4+ years of health care/managed care experience
  • 2+ years of provider relations and/or provider network experience
  • 1+ years of experience with Medicare and Medicaid regulations
  • Intermediate level of proficiency in claims processing and issue resolution
  • Intermediate level of proficiency with M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Access

Nice To Haves

  • Undergraduate degree
  • Ability to research and resolve issues
  • Strong organization and follow through skills
  • Ability to manage competing priorities

Responsibilities

  • Assist in end-to-end provider claims and help enhance quality relationships with the providers
  • Assist in efforts to enhance ease of use of physician portal and future services enhancements
  • Contribute to design and implementation of programs that build/nurture positive relationships between the health plan, providers and practice managers
  • Support development and management of provider networks
  • Help implement training and development of external providers through education programs
  • Identify gaps in network composition and services to assist network contracting and development teams
